This flavorful mash of Japanese sweet potatoes, turnips, and leeks are a smooth, starchy, and buttery base for these meaty maitake mushroom steaks and is also the perfect side to serve alongside a saucy stew or braise.

Steps:
- Combine potatoes and turnips in a pot and cover with water by 2 inches. Bring to a boil; season generously with salt. Boil until vegetables are tender and easily pierced with the tip of a knife, 12 to 15 minutes. Reserve 1 cup cooking water, then drain and return vegetables to pot.
- Meanwhile, mel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Add leeks, season with salt, and cook, stirring a few times, until leeks are tender but not developing any color, 5 to 7 minutes.
- Transfer mixture to pot with vegetables, along with 1/3 cup reserved cooking water and sesame oil. Mash to combine; season with salt, white pepper, and more sesame oil, 1/4 teaspoon at a time. Stir in more cooking water, a little at a time, to reach desired consistency.
